[][src]Enum keycode::KeyMappingId

pub enum KeyMappingId {
    Equal,
    F7,
    Escape,
    Lang5,
    NumpadDecimal,
    ShowAllWindows,
    Eject,
    Digit5,
    PrintScreen,
    AltLeft,
    LaunchScreenSaver,
    LaunchCalendar,
    Info,
    SpeechInputToggle,
    MediaTrackPrevious,
    BracketRight,
    Numpad3,
    F16,
    LaunchMail,
    Comma,
    Numpad6,
    BrightnessUp,
    F24,
    F9,
    Numpad4,
    Minus,
    NumpadBackspace,
    Numpad8,
    UsC,
    Redo,
    UsbPostFail,
    Enter,
    UsG,
    F8,
    Home,
    WakeUp,
    Quote,
    ArrowLeft,
    None,
    Numpad7,
    UsA,
    ArrowUp,
    UsJ,
    UsL,
    LaunchApp2,
    NumLock,
    NumpadDivide,
    UsT,
    Print,
    LaunchWordProcessor,
    Find,
    ArrowRight,
    Save,
    UsE,
    Select,
    Convert,
    Lang3,
    NumpadMemoryClear,
    SelectTask,
    LaunchAssistant,
    F20,
    NumpadClearEntry,
    PageUp,
    Help,
    BrowserForward,
    LaunchPhone,
    LockScreen,
    F1,
    PageDown,
    F10,
    Copy,
    AltRight,
    Pause,
    LaunchApp1,
    LogOff,
    Digit3,
    Digit2,
    F13,
    F4,
    UsY,
    New,
    UsQ,
    MailForward,
    Abort,
    Numpad1,
    BrowserRefresh,
    UsD,
    MailSend,
    Tab,
    BrightnessMaximum,
    NumpadEqual,
    F6,
    F12,
    KeyboardLayoutSelect,
    Digit8,
    UsF,
    Period,
    ArrowDown,
    UsB,
    UsN,
    Suspend,
    UsW,
    VolumeDown,
    ChannelDown,
    Del,
    LaunchDocuments,
    LaunchSpreadsheet,
    MediaTrackNext,
    ScrollLock,
    F21,
    Fn,
    UsZ,
    ControlRight,
    MediaRewind,
    Hyper,
    ProgramGuide,
    LaunchKeyboardLayout,
    Numpad2,
    UsbReserved,
    Semicolon,
    BassBoost,
    UsbErrorUndefined,
    Digit7,
    Turbo,
    BrightnessDown,
    Numpad0,
    UsK,
    Digit0,
    Lang1,
    NumpadMemorySubtract,
    LaunchAudioBrowser,
    Power,
    BrowserBack,
    UsI,
    NumpadAdd,
    ClosedCaptionToggle,
    Backquote,
    Digit9,
    UsX,
    MetaRight,
    Slash,
    UsbErrorRollOver,
    MediaStop,
    ShiftLeft,
    UsH,
    Close,
    BrowserStop,
    F3,
    UsU,
    UsO,
    MediaPlayPause,
    Resume,
    CapsLock,
    NumpadSubtract,
    Undo,
    F18,
    KanaMode,
    ContextMenu,
    MediaFastForward,
    UsR,
    Space,
    Numpad9,
    IntlHash,
    MediaRecord,
    MediaSelect,
    IntlYen,
    IntlRo,
    ChannelUp,
    Sleep,
    NumpadEnter,
    VolumeMute,
    NumpadParenLeft,
    ZoomOut,
    BracketLeft,
    ControlLeft,
    LaunchControlPanel,
    MailReply,
    F17,
    MetaLeft,
    MediaPlay,
    MediaLast,
    Numpad5,
    NumpadMultiply,
    ZoomToggle,
    Paste,
    ShiftRight,
    Lang2,
    FnLock,
    Again,
    Digit4,
    Digit1,
    F2,
    NumpadClear,
    BrowserFavorites,
    ZoomIn,
    NumpadComma,
    UsP,
    BrowserSearch,
    UsS,
    UsV,
    F5,
    NumpadMemoryRecall,
    BrowserHome,
    End,
    NumpadSignChange,
    BrightnessMinimium,
    Super,
    Props,
    UsM,
    F15,
    F23,
    Backspace,
    Insert,
    VolumeUp,
    Digit6,
    Lang4,
    DisplayToggleIntExt,
    Backslash,
    F19,
    BrightnessToggle,
    NumpadParenRight,
    Exit,
    NumpadMemoryAdd,
    LaunchContacts,
    Open,
    LaunchInternetBrowser,
    IntlBackslash,
    F14,
    Cut,
    BrightnessAuto,
    NonConvert,
    NumpadMemoryStore,
    SpellCheck,
    F11,
    F22,
}

Id for a specific key

Variants

Equal

Id for a specific key

F7

Id for a specific key

Escape

Id for a specific key

Lang5

Id for a specific key

NumpadDecimal

Id for a specific key

ShowAllWindows

Id for a specific key

Eject

Id for a specific key

Digit5

Id for a specific key

PrintScreen

Id for a specific key

AltLeft

Id for a specific key

LaunchScreenSaver

Id for a specific key

LaunchCalendar

Id for a specific key

Info

Id for a specific key

SpeechInputToggle

Id for a specific key

MediaTrackPrevious

Id for a specific key

BracketRight

Id for a specific key

Numpad3

Id for a specific key

F16

Id for a specific key

LaunchMail

Id for a specific key

Comma

Id for a specific key

Numpad6

Id for a specific key

BrightnessUp

Id for a specific key

F24

Id for a specific key

F9

Id for a specific key

Numpad4

Id for a specific key

Minus

Id for a specific key

NumpadBackspace

Id for a specific key

Numpad8

Id for a specific key

UsC

Id for a specific key

Redo

Id for a specific key

UsbPostFail

Id for a specific key

Enter

Id for a specific key

UsG

Id for a specific key

F8

Id for a specific key

Home

Id for a specific key

WakeUp

Id for a specific key

Quote

Id for a specific key

ArrowLeft

Id for a specific key

None

Id for a specific key

Numpad7

Id for a specific key

UsA

Id for a specific key

ArrowUp

Id for a specific key

UsJ

Id for a specific key

UsL

Id for a specific key

LaunchApp2

Id for a specific key

NumLock

Id for a specific key

NumpadDivide

Id for a specific key

UsT

Id for a specific key

Print

Id for a specific key

LaunchWordProcessor

Id for a specific key

Find

Id for a specific key

ArrowRight

Id for a specific key

Save

Id for a specific key

UsE

Id for a specific key

Select

Id for a specific key

Convert

Id for a specific key

Lang3

Id for a specific key

NumpadMemoryClear

Id for a specific key

SelectTask

Id for a specific key

LaunchAssistant

Id for a specific key

F20

Id for a specific key

NumpadClearEntry

Id for a specific key

PageUp

Id for a specific key

Help

Id for a specific key

BrowserForward

Id for a specific key

LaunchPhone

Id for a specific key

LockScreen

Id for a specific key

F1

Id for a specific key

PageDown

Id for a specific key

F10

Id for a specific key

Copy

Id for a specific key

AltRight

Id for a specific key

Pause

Id for a specific key

LaunchApp1

Id for a specific key

LogOff

Id for a specific key

Digit3

Id for a specific key

Digit2

Id for a specific key

F13

Id for a specific key

F4

Id for a specific key

UsY

Id for a specific key

New

Id for a specific key

UsQ

Id for a specific key

MailForward

Id for a specific key

Abort

Id for a specific key

Numpad1

Id for a specific key

BrowserRefresh

Id for a specific key

UsD

Id for a specific key

MailSend

Id for a specific key

Tab

Id for a specific key

BrightnessMaximum

Id for a specific key

NumpadEqual

Id for a specific key

F6

Id for a specific key

F12

Id for a specific key

KeyboardLayoutSelect

Id for a specific key

Digit8

Id for a specific key

UsF

Id for a specific key

Period

Id for a specific key

ArrowDown

Id for a specific key

UsB

Id for a specific key

UsN

Id for a specific key

Suspend

Id for a specific key

UsW

Id for a specific key

VolumeDown

Id for a specific key

ChannelDown

Id for a specific key

Del

Id for a specific key

LaunchDocuments

Id for a specific key

LaunchSpreadsheet

Id for a specific key

MediaTrackNext

Id for a specific key

ScrollLock

Id for a specific key

F21

Id for a specific key

Fn

Id for a specific key

UsZ

Id for a specific key

ControlRight

Id for a specific key

MediaRewind

Id for a specific key

Hyper

Id for a specific key

ProgramGuide

Id for a specific key

LaunchKeyboardLayout

Id for a specific key

Numpad2

Id for a specific key

UsbReserved

Id for a specific key

Semicolon

Id for a specific key

BassBoost

Id for a specific key

UsbErrorUndefined

Id for a specific key

Digit7

Id for a specific key

Turbo

Id for a specific key

BrightnessDown

Id for a specific key

Numpad0

Id for a specific key

UsK

Id for a specific key

Digit0

Id for a specific key

Lang1

Id for a specific key

NumpadMemorySubtract

Id for a specific key

LaunchAudioBrowser

Id for a specific key

Power

Id for a specific key

BrowserBack

Id for a specific key

UsI

Id for a specific key

NumpadAdd

Id for a specific key

ClosedCaptionToggle

Id for a specific key

Backquote

Id for a specific key

Digit9

Id for a specific key

UsX

Id for a specific key

MetaRight

Id for a specific key

Slash

Id for a specific key

UsbErrorRollOver

Id for a specific key

MediaStop

Id for a specific key

ShiftLeft

Id for a specific key

UsH

Id for a specific key

Close

Id for a specific key

BrowserStop

Id for a specific key

F3

Id for a specific key

UsU

Id for a specific key

UsO

Id for a specific key

MediaPlayPause

Id for a specific key

Resume

Id for a specific key

CapsLock

Id for a specific key

NumpadSubtract

Id for a specific key

Undo

Id for a specific key

F18

Id for a specific key

KanaMode

Id for a specific key

ContextMenu

Id for a specific key

MediaFastForward

Id for a specific key

UsR

Id for a specific key

Space

Id for a specific key

Numpad9

Id for a specific key

IntlHash

Id for a specific key

MediaRecord

Id for a specific key

MediaSelect

Id for a specific key

IntlYen

Id for a specific key

IntlRo

Id for a specific key

ChannelUp

Id for a specific key

Sleep

Id for a specific key

NumpadEnter

Id for a specific key

VolumeMute

Id for a specific key

NumpadParenLeft

Id for a specific key

ZoomOut

Id for a specific key

BracketLeft

Id for a specific key

ControlLeft

Id for a specific key

LaunchControlPanel

Id for a specific key

MailReply

Id for a specific key

F17

Id for a specific key

MetaLeft

Id for a specific key

MediaPlay

Id for a specific key

MediaLast

Id for a specific key

Numpad5

Id for a specific key

NumpadMultiply

Id for a specific key

ZoomToggle

Id for a specific key

Paste

Id for a specific key

ShiftRight

Id for a specific key

Lang2

Id for a specific key

FnLock

Id for a specific key

Again

Id for a specific key

Digit4

Id for a specific key

Digit1

Id for a specific key

F2

Id for a specific key

NumpadClear

Id for a specific key

BrowserFavorites

Id for a specific key

ZoomIn

Id for a specific key

NumpadComma

Id for a specific key

UsP

Id for a specific key

BrowserSearch

Id for a specific key

UsS

Id for a specific key

UsV

Id for a specific key

F5

Id for a specific key

NumpadMemoryRecall

Id for a specific key

BrowserHome

Id for a specific key

End

Id for a specific key

NumpadSignChange

Id for a specific key

BrightnessMinimium

Id for a specific key

Super

Id for a specific key

Props

Id for a specific key

UsM

Id for a specific key

F15

Id for a specific key

F23

Id for a specific key

Backspace

Id for a specific key

Insert

Id for a specific key

VolumeUp

Id for a specific key

Digit6

Id for a specific key

Lang4

Id for a specific key

DisplayToggleIntExt

Id for a specific key

Backslash

Id for a specific key

F19

Id for a specific key

BrightnessToggle

Id for a specific key

NumpadParenRight

Id for a specific key

Exit

Id for a specific key

NumpadMemoryAdd

Id for a specific key

LaunchContacts

Id for a specific key

Open

Id for a specific key

LaunchInternetBrowser

Id for a specific key

IntlBackslash

Id for a specific key

F14

Id for a specific key

Cut

Id for a specific key

BrightnessAuto

Id for a specific key

NonConvert

Id for a specific key

NumpadMemoryStore

Id for a specific key

SpellCheck

Id for a specific key

F11

Id for a specific key

F22

Id for a specific key

Trait Implementations

impl Clone for KeyMappingId[src]

impl Copy for KeyMappingId[src]

impl Debug for KeyMappingId[src]

impl Display for KeyMappingId[src]

impl Eq for KeyMappingId[src]

impl From<KeyMappingId> for KeyMap[src]

impl Hash for KeyMappingId[src]

impl PartialEq<KeyMappingId> for KeyMappingId[src]

impl StructuralEq for KeyMappingId[src]

impl StructuralPartialEq for KeyMappingId[src]

Auto Trait Implementations

Blanket Implementations

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> Borrow<T> for T where
    T: ?Sized
[src]

impl<T> BorrowMut<T> for T where
    T: ?Sized
[src]

impl<T> From<T> for T[src]

impl<T, U> Into<U> for T where
    U: From<T>, 
[src]

impl<T, U> TryFrom<U> for T where
    U: Into<T>, 
[src]

type Error = Infallible

The type returned in the event of a conversion error.

impl<T, U> TryInto<U> for T where
    U: TryFrom<T>, 
[src]

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.